Orbilia querci sp. nov. and its knob-forming nematophagous anamorph.

Orbilia querci, a new nematode-trapping fungus, was found on rotten wood of Quercus sp. in Huai-rou County, Beijing, China. It is characterized by having a tear-shaped spore body in the cylindrical ascospore. Pure culture was obtained from the ascospores. Ascomycetes of New Zealand 6. Atricordyceps harposporifera gen. et sp. nov. and its Harposporium anamorph

Atricordyceps harposporifera gen. et sp. nov. (Clavicipitales) was found growing on the cadaver of an arthropod, possibly a millipede. An anamorph morphologically indistinguishable from Harposporium anguillulae, a nematode endoparasite, formed in cultures derived from single ascospores.

Aquatic fungi from peat swamp palms: Phruensis brunneispora gen. et sp. nov. and its hyphomycete anamorph.

Phruensis brunneispora is a new genus and species occurring on decaying trunks of the palm Licuala longecalycata in Sirindhorn Peat Swamp Forest, Thailand. We compare the genus with other aquatic ascomycetes with falcate septate ascospores: Pseudohalonectria and Ophioceras. Mycosphaerella species associated with Eucalyptus in south-western Australia: new species, new records and a key.

Mycosphaerella ambiphylla sp. nov. (anamorph: Phaeophleospora) and Mycosphaerella aurantia sp. nov., are described from diseased Eucalyptus globulus leaves. In addition, a new fungal record in Australia, M. mexicana, and two new records for Western Australia, M. gregaria and M. parva, are discussed. A key is provided to Mycosphaerella species on E. globulus in Western Australia.
